How courts have described this case
Verbatim parenthetical descriptions written by other courts when citing this decision. Ranked by citation-network relevance.
- explaining that equitable estoppel requires the party raising the defense to show he lacked the opportunity to know the truth, and denying application of the defense because appellants, “through diligent research, had every opportunity to know of the [relevant legal] decisions.”
- inappropriate to apply judicial estoppel to changed legal position rather than inconsistent sworn statements

- “[T]he res judicata consequences of a final, unappealed judgment on the merits [are not] altered by the fact that the judgment may have been wrong or rested on a legal principle subsequently overruled in another case.”
